Yum! Brands is seeking an NRM Business Analyst to support high impact Net Revenue Management (NRM) initiatives across global markets. This role plays a critical part in translating complex data into structured insights and actionable recommendations across pricing, value architecture, promotional strategy, menu optimization, and channel growth. As part of the Global NRM COE, the Business Analyst will support strategy development from problem definition through executive-ready deliverables. This role requires strong analytical rigor, structured problem-solving, advanced Excel capability, and the ability to connect data to hypothesis-driven commercial recommendations.
Job Responsibility
Support end-to-end NRM projects, including problem definition, disaggregating issue trees, identifying key analyses, and structuring workstreams
Conduct detailed data analyses including day-part analysis, menu architecture analysis, channel profitability analysis, cost of sales (COS%) and contribution margin analysis
Analyze pricing, mix, traffic, and transaction data to identify opportunities for SSSG and AUV growth
Perform data cleansing and validation across large datasets
slice and manipulate data using advanced Excel (pivot tables, lookups, scenario modeling)
Decode and analyze consumer survey data and market research to inform KVI strategy and value perception insights
Develop clear, client-ready slides and data visualizations that translate analysis into structured insights and actionable recommendations within NRM frameworks
Requirements
Bachelor's degree in Business, Finance, Economics, Engineering, or related analytical field
At least 3 years of experience in management consulting, corporate strategy, analytics, finance, or related analytical roles
At least 3 years of advanced Excel experience, including pivot tables, large dataset manipulation, scenario modeling, and structured analysis
Experience building executive-ready PowerPoint presentations based on quantitative analysis
Demonstrated experience working with structured problem-solving approaches (e.g., hypothesis-driven analysis, issue trees)
